Repair-AzVmssServiceFabricUpdateDomain

Guide pratique pour mettre à jour des machines virtuelles dans un groupe de machines virtuelles identiques Service Fabric.

Syntax

Repair-AzVmssServiceFabricUpdateDomain
      [-ResourceGroupName] <String>
      [-VMScaleSetName] <String>
      [-PlatformUpdateDomain] <Int32>
      [-Zone <String>]
      [-PlacementGroupId <String>]
      [-AsJob]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Repair-AzVmssServiceFabricUpdateDomain
      [-PlatformUpdateDomain] <Int32>
      [-Zone <String>]
      [-PlacementGroupId <String>]
      [-ResourceId] <String>
      [-AsJob]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]
Repair-AzVmssServiceFabricUpdateDomain
      [-PlatformUpdateDomain] <Int32>
      [-Zone <String>]
      [-PlacementGroupId <String>]
      [-VirtualMachineScaleSet] <PSVirtualMachineScaleSet>
      [-AsJob]
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

Forcer la procédure manuelle de mise à jour du domaine de mise à jour de plateforme pour mettre à jour les machines virtuelles dans un groupe de machines virtuelles identiques Service Fabric.

Exemples

Exemple 1

Repair-AzVmssServiceFabricUpdateDomain -ResourceGroupName $rgname -VMScaleSetName $vmssName -PlatformUpdateDomain 0

Cette commande force la procédure de mise à jour service Fabric sur UD 0 pour le groupe de machines virtuelles identiques spécifié par le nom du groupe de ressources et le nom du groupe identique.

Exemple 2

$vmss = Get-AzVmss -ResourceGroupName $rgname -VMScaleSetName $vmssName
Repair-AzVmssServiceFabricUpdateDomain -VirtualMachineScaleSet $vmss -PlatformUpdateDomain 1

Cette commande force la procédure de mise à jour service fabric sur UD 1 pour le groupe de machines virtuelles identiques spécifié par l’objet de groupe identique de machine virtuelle.

Exemple 3

Repair-AzVmssServiceFabricUpdateDomain -ResourceId $resourceId  -PlatformUpdateDomain 2;

Cette commande force la procédure de mise à jour service Fabric sur UD 2 pour le groupe de machines virtuelles identiques spécifié par l’ID de ressource.

Paramètres

-AsJob

Exécuter l’applet de commande en arrière-plan

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Confirm

Vous demande une confirmation avant d’exécuter l’applet de commande.

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Informations d’identification, compte, locataire et abonnement utilisés pour la communication avec Azure.

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-PlacementGroupId

ID du groupe de placement des machines virtuelles

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-PlatformUpdateDomain

Domaine de mise à jour de plateforme pour lequel une procédure de récupération manuelle est demandée.

Type:Int32
Position:2
Default value:None
Required:True
Accept pipeline input:False
Accept wildcard characters:False

-ResourceGroupName

Nom du groupe de ressources.

Type:String
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-ResourceId

ID de ressource du groupe de machines virtuelles identiques.

Type:String
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-VirtualMachineScaleSet

Objet de groupe de machines virtuelles identiques local

Type:PSVirtualMachineScaleSet
Position:0
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-VMScaleSetName

Nom du groupe de machines virtuelles identiques

Type:String
Aliases:Name
Position:1
Default value:None
Required:True
Accept pipeline input:True
Accept wildcard characters:False

-WhatIf

Montre ce qui se passe en cas d’exécution de l’applet de commande. L’applet de commande n’est pas exécutée.

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-Zone

Zone des machines virtuelles

Type:String
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

Entrées

String

PSVirtualMachineScaleSet

Sorties

PSRecoveryWalkResponse